1. The Minimalist Look

Incorporate black and white into your ensemble. It is the easiest way to create a monochromatic office look that’s chic and sophisticated at the same time! A plain white blouse or shirt paired with a sleek black pencil skirt will flatter any figure while adding a stylish yet professional note to your appearance. If you want to add some color without going overboard, wear your statement necklace in vivid red or pick up a pair of red suede pumps instead. Another option is wearing a printed top with solid pants or skirt – it’s an unexpected yet amazing style combo that works well if you’re daring enough!

2. The Cardigan And Blouse Combo

If you’re casual about your work attire or aim for a more bohemian look, try pairing an oversize cardigan with a crisp white blouse. It is one of the easiest ways to make yourself look polished without looking too stiff and uptight in the office. You can even add office-friendly accessories, like a simple pearl necklace or bracelet, to elevate this outfit for business occasions.

4. The Black And White Shirtdress

The shirtdress is one of the most versatile styles worn throughout all four seasons for work. Not only does it give your outfit an elegant and authoritative vibe, but it also ensures comfort during long office hours. Due to its easy fit and unrestricted cut—not to mention how effortless it is to maintain with minimal washing! If you feel like adding some pizzazz to this classic ensemble, opt for statement accessories, so you don’t look too dull. Layer on necklaces, bracelets, rings, belts, watches, handbags – anything goes as long as they are bold enough!

5. Knitwear Is Here To Stay

For the cold winter months, you can choose to dress up more casually by wearing simple outfits with your favorite knitwear. Whether it’s knitted dresses, cardigans, or sweaters, this type of seasonal must-have is perfect for when you want to stay warm but look stylish at the same time! Sweater dresses make the best office outfits because they are stretchy, high on comfort, and polished and chic. To bring out the femininity in these cozy pieces without looking too casual, stick to items that have an A-line cut and wear them with pointed pumps. It’s one of the simplest styles that will never go out of style.
